## MIGraphX 2.12 for ROCm 6.4.0 | ||||||
|
||||||
### Added | ||||||
|
||||||
* Support for gfx1200 and gfx1201 | ||||||
* hipBLASLt support for contiguous transpose GEMM fusion and GEMM pointwise fusions for improved performance | ||||||
* Support for hardware specific FP8 datatypes (FP8 OCP and FP8 FNUZ) | ||||||
* Add support for the BF16 datatype | ||||||
* ONNX Operator Support for `com.microsoft.MultiHeadAttention`, `com.microsoft.NhwcConv`, and `com.microsoft.MatMulIntgerFloat` | ||||||
* migraphx-driver can now produce outfor for use with Netron | ||||||
* migraphx-driver now includes a `time` parameter (similar to `perf`) that is more accurate for very fast kernels | ||||||
* An end-to-end Stable Diffusion 3 example with option to disable T5 encoder on VRAM-limited GPUs has been added | ||||||
* Added support to track broadcast axes in `shape_transform_descriptor` | ||||||
* Added support for unsigned types with `rocMLIR` | ||||||
* Added a script to convert mxr files to ONNX models | ||||||
* Added the `MIGRAPHX_SET_GEMM_PROVIDER` environment variable to choose between rocBLAS and hipBLASLt. Set `MIGRAPHX_SET_GEMM_PROVIDER` to `rocblas` to use rocBLAS, or to `hipblaslt` to use hipBLASLt. | ||||||
|
||||||
|
||||||
### Changed | ||||||
|
||||||
* With the exception of gfx90a, switched to using hipBLASLt instead of rocBLAS | ||||||
* Included the min/max/median of the `perf` run as part of the summary report | ||||||
* Enable non-packed inputs for `rocMLIR` | ||||||
* Always output a packed type for q/dq after determining non-packed tensors were inefficient | ||||||
* Even if using NHWC, MIGraphX will always convert group convolutions to NCHW for best performance | ||||||

* Renamed the `layout_nhwc` to `layout_convolution` and ensured that either the weights are the same layout as the inputs or set the input and weights to NHWC | ||||||
* Minimum version of Cmake is now 3.27 | ||||||
|
||||||
|
||||||
### Removed | ||||||
|
||||||
* Removed `fp8e5m2fnuz` rocBLAS support | ||||||
* `__AMDGCN_WAVEFRONT_SIZE` has been deprecated. | ||||||
* Removed a warning that printed to stdout when using FP8 types | ||||||
* Remove zero point parameter for dequantizelinear when its zero | ||||||

### Optimized | ||||||
|
||||||
* Prefill buffers when MLIR produces a multioutput buffer | ||||||

* Improved the resize operator performance which should improve overall performance of models that use it | ||||||
* Allow the `reduce` operator to be split across an axis to improve fusion performance. The `MIGRAPHX_SPLIT_REDUCE_SIZE` environment variable has been added to allow the minimum size of the reduction to be adjusted for a possible model specific performance improvement | ||||||
* Added `MIGRAPHX_DISABLE_PASSES` environment variable for debugging | ||||||
* Added `MIGRAPHX_MLIR_DUMP` environment variable to be set to a folder where individual final rocMLIR modules can be saved for investigation | ||||||
* Improved the C++ API to allow onnxruntime access to fp8 quantization | ||||||
